Answer:

[tex]s =\frac{3}{40}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

Let find the middle point between both rationals. That is to say:

[tex]s = \frac{-\frac{1}{4}+\frac{2}{5} }{2}[/tex]

[tex]s = \frac{\frac{-5+8}{20} }{2}[/tex]

[tex]s =\frac{3}{40}[/tex]
